Which types or mixes of fill dirt work best for residential driveways in Tiki Island's coastal environment?

For Tiki Island's coastal, often high-water-table conditions, use well-graded, low-organic structural fill (clean fill) or engineered road base rather than plain topsoil or organic-rich fill dirt. A blend with crushed stone or road base on top of compacted structural fill gives better drainage and longevity against salt and occasional flooding.

How do I calculate how many tons of fill dirt I need (example: 1,000 sq ft raised 6 inches)?

Convert to cubic yards first: (area in sq ft x depth in feet) / 27. For 1,000 sq ft at 6 inches (0.5 ft): (1,000 x 0.5) / 27 = about 18.5 cubic yards. Multiply by the local weight factor (use 1.2 to 1.4 tons per cubic yard for fill dirt) to get tons — at 1.3 tons/yd3 that equals roughly 24 tons; always order 5-10% extra for settling and compaction.

Are permits or shoreline/erosion rules required for importing large volumes of fill dirt to Tiki Island?

Yes, because Tiki Island is a coastal community, adding large volumes of fill near shorelines or in low-lying lots may trigger local or state permits. Check with the City of Tiki Island, Galveston County, the Texas General Land Office, and possibly the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ers before placing large orders, and let your supplier know if the site is in a regulated zone.

How long will fill dirt last on Tiki Island and how much maintenance should I expect?

Properly compacted structural fill can hold its shape for many years, but expect some settling, especially in coastal, saturated soils. Plan on light regrading or topping up after major storms or within the first year if compaction wasn't optimal, and inspect annually after heavy rains or storm surge events.

When should I use fill dirt versus crushed limestone, road base, or clean fill for Tiki Island driveways and low yards?

Use plain fill dirt to raise grade or fill large voids but not as a finished driving surface. For driveways and areas exposed to moisture or traffic, use road base or crushed limestone over compacted structural fill—those materials drain and compact better and resist erosion in coastal conditions. Clean engineered fill is preferred where stability and low organic content are required.

What are the best practices for installing fill dirt under pavers or patios in Tiki Island?

Remove organic topsoil, lay a geotextile fabric over problematic soils, then bring in well-graded structural fill compacted in 4-6 inch lifts to the specified density. Finish with a compacted bedding layer (stone dust or sand) and ensure a drainage plan that routes water away from the paved area to avoid saturation and shifting.

Are there seasonal or weather-related considerations for ordering and installing fill dirt in Tiki Island?

Yes. Avoid deliveries during heavy rain windows, high tides, or when storm surge is forecast because wet ground reduces compaction effectiveness and can block truck access. Schedule deliveries in drier periods when possible and confirm a backup date with your supplier if weather could delay work.

What compaction specifications should I aim for when placing fill dirt in coastal Tiki Island projects?

Aim for at least 90% of the Standard Proctor dry density for general structural fill, unless a local engineer specifies otherwise for flood-plain or coastal settings. Achieving this requires placing fill in thin lifts (typically 4-6 inches) and using appropriate compaction equipment; ask contractors to provide compaction testing if the grade change affects structures or utilities.
